March 2025 workforce snapshot. Administration for Children and Families had 2,296 employees with an average salary of $135,154. It sits under the Department of Health and Human Services.
2,296 employees
$135,154 average pay
$310,313,584 estimated total salary expense
Social Science largest occupation in the agency

Largest occupations in Administration for Children and Families

These occupation series account for the biggest share of employees reported under Administration for Children and Families.

Occupation Employees Average pay Share of agency
Social Science 1,047 $131,090 45.6%
Management and Program Analysis 279 $136,552 12.2%
Miscellaneous Administration and Program 249 $142,731 10.8%
Grants Management 139 $126,690 6.1%
Contracting 93 $144,104 4.1%
Information Technology Management 71 $163,204 3.1%
Budget Analysis 42 $154,314 1.8%
General Business and Industry 37 $139,006 1.6%
Financial Administration and Program 29 $125,937 1.3%
Administrative Officer 27 $139,066 1.2%
Administration and Office Support Student Trainee 13 $67,476 0.6%
Emergency Management Specialist 12 $139,401 0.5%
Program Management 11 $188,989 0.5%

Where Administration for Children and Families employees are based

This list shows the biggest duty-station states reported for Administration for Children and Families in the latest OPM summary.

State Employees Average pay
District of Columbia 891 $146,136
Texas 207 $117,232
Georgia 127 $117,348
Maryland 115 $145,584
California 104 $140,151
Illinois 102 $126,969
New York 96 $134,824
Pennsylvania 73 $134,492
Virginia 66 $140,757
Colorado 62 $133,879

Agency totals and duty-location summaries come from the latest OPM FedScope Employment Summary Data (March 2025).
